Your Guide to Doorman Buildings in NYC

In my 25+ years representing buyers across Manhattan, Brooklyn, and Queens, doorman buildings consistently rank among the most requested filters I hear. A full-time doorman building in NYC offers a combination of package acceptance, visitor management, and building access control that many co-op and condo buyers consider non-negotiable. The premium varies significantly by borough: in Upper East Side white-glove co-ops, doorman service is standard. In Long Island City condos, it signals a full-service building tier. Beyond convenience, doorman buildings in NYC typically carry higher monthly maintenance or common charges, so understanding what that fee covers is critical before making an offer.

FAQ: What is the difference between a full-time doorman and a part-time or virtual doorman?

A full-time doorman building is staffed 24 hours a day, 7 days a week. A part-time doorman building may only have coverage during daytime or evening hours. Virtual doorman systems use intercom cameras and remote staff. Always confirm the staffing hours in the offering plan or house rules before assuming full coverage.

FAQ: Do doorman buildings cost more than non-doorman buildings?

Yes, on average, doorman buildings carry a 15-25% price premium per square foot compared to comparable non-doorman buildings in the same neighborhood. FAQ: Can a co-op board vote to eliminate doorman service?

Yes. A co-op board can vote to reduce or eliminate doorman hours, which is one reason I always review board meeting minutes going back 2-3 years before a client makes an offer. Condo buildings operate similarly through their board of managers. Always request minutes as part of your due diligence process.

Buying Tip from Milton Coste

When touring a doorman building, introduce yourself to the staff. Experienced doormen often know everything about a building's culture, how responsive the super is, and how long current owners have lived there. Also verify whether the doorman is employed directly by the building or through a third-party contractor, as this affects labor stability and building cost structure.
